FAB-Design Mercedes-Benz SLS AMG

BY Joel Tam

Swiss tuner FAB-Design has taken the SLS AMG to a new level. True to the company's philosophy of creating something more exclusive than the factory vehicle, the FAB-Design SLS is the result.

One of the main areas FAB-Design focused on was aerodynamics. To improve the already phenomenal SLS (it can drive upside dwn after all), developers from Mellingen developed and mounted a front spoiler lip with vertically mounted daylight driving lights along with a rear apron with integrated diffuser in a similar design to the front element.
An equally output-boosting rear spoiler that was specially constructed to harmonise with the factory mounted extendable counterpart crowns it all.

The optical and aerodynamic cherry on the SLS cake are the side skirts made of visible carbon fiber. A further highlight on the retro-sportscar are the 3-piece 20" Evoline wheels. The classic hole-design complimenting the equally classic sportscar silhouette of the FAB-Design SLS.

In addition, a sports suspension was mounted that equally satisfies the requirement for both comfort and sport. At the rear of the vehicle a FAB stainless steel sports exhaust with four oval endpipes lets the exhaust gases go sonorously free. Integrated valve steering gives the driver the possibility - according to the occasion - of choosing between a sonorous and a discrete sound. The FAB developers also worked on the improving the performance and thereby achieved an every day capability of 611 bhp - instead of the normal 571 bhp of factory vehicles.
